Genetic Diabetes

Many people still don't understand what hereditary diabetes is on a global scale. This makes it possible for people to go through pre- diabetic stages without ever realising it, which results in a wide range of issues. Some persons are predisposed to developing diabetic problems as a result of inherited elements that are triggered. From birth, we are predisposed to diabetes, and our environment serves as the trigger. But this isn't always the case. The diabetic circumstances may be thresholded by other events.
